Mary-Dell Chilton Papers 1947 - 1999

The Mary-Dell Chilton Papers include laboratory records, correspondence, notes, manuscripts, reprints, articles, and photographs from 1947 through 1999 documenting Chilton's career as a plant geneticist. The bulk of the records are from the late 1970s and early 1980s. Mary-Dell Chilton has worked as a plant geneticist and genetic engineer throughout her career at the University of Washington, Washington University in St. Louis, and at Syngenta Biotechnology, Inc. in Research Triangle Park in North Carolina.

7.75 Linear feet
